>Description:
Hi,
after upgrading from Samba 3.6.7 to 3.6.8 "something" was wrong with the AD membership:
* net ads testjoin => OK
* wbinfo -P => failed
* wbinfo -t => failed
winbindd logs a lot of these messages:
winbindd/winbindd_cm.c:1015(cm_prepare_connection)
failed tcon_X with N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ED
Oct 23 13:22:00 pc1 winbindd[42932]: [2012/10/23 13:22:00.194727, 0] winbindd/winbindd_util.c:635(init_domain_list)
Oct 23 13:22:00 pc1 winbindd[42932]: Could not fetch our SID - did we join?
Oct 23 13:22:00 pc1 winbindd[42932]: [2012/10/23 13:22:00.194825, 0] winbindd/winbindd.c:1108(winbindd_register_handlers)
Oct 23 13:22:00 pc1 winbindd[42932]: unable to initialize domain list
Joining the domain again failed because "net" segfaulted:
